Buying Guide for the Best Coffee Makers

Choosing the right coffee maker can significantly enhance your coffee experience. Whether you are a casual coffee drinker or a passionate aficionado, understanding the key specifications will help you find a coffee maker that suits your needs and preferences. Consider factors such as the type of coffee you enjoy, the convenience you seek, and the features that will make your coffee-making process enjoyable and efficient.
Type of Coffee MakerCoffee makers come in various types, including drip coffee makers, single-serve pod machines, espresso machines, and French presses. The type of coffee maker is important because it determines the brewing method and the kind of coffee you can make. Drip coffee makers are great for making multiple cups at once and are ideal for regular coffee drinkers. Single-serve pod machines offer convenience and variety but can be more expensive per cup. Espresso machines are perfect for those who love strong, concentrated coffee and enjoy making specialty drinks. French presses provide a rich, full-bodied coffee experience and are great for those who appreciate the manual brewing process. Choose the type that aligns with your coffee preferences and lifestyle.
CapacityCapacity refers to the amount of coffee a machine can brew at one time. This is important because it affects how much coffee you can make and how often you need to refill the machine. Coffee makers typically range from single-serve options to large machines that can brew up to 12 cups. If you live alone or only drink one cup at a time, a single-serve or small-capacity machine may be sufficient. For families or those who entertain guests, a larger capacity machine will be more convenient. Consider your daily coffee consumption and choose a capacity that matches your needs.
Brewing TimeBrewing time is the amount of time it takes for the coffee maker to brew a pot of coffee. This is important for those who value convenience and speed, especially during busy mornings. Brewing times can vary significantly between different types of coffee makers. Drip coffee makers and single-serve machines typically have shorter brewing times, while espresso machines and French presses may take longer. If you need your coffee quickly, look for a machine with a shorter brewing time. If you enjoy the process and don't mind waiting, a longer brewing time may be acceptable.
Programmable FeaturesProgrammable features allow you to set your coffee maker to start brewing at a specific time, adjust the strength of the coffee, and even control the temperature. These features are important for convenience and customization. If you have a busy schedule, programmable features can ensure you have fresh coffee ready when you wake up or come home. For those who like to experiment with different coffee strengths and temperatures, these features offer greater control over the brewing process. Consider how much control and convenience you want and choose a coffee maker with the appropriate programmable features.
Ease of CleaningEase of cleaning refers to how simple it is to clean and maintain the coffee maker. This is important for hygiene and the longevity of the machine. Coffee makers with removable parts, dishwasher-safe components, and self-cleaning functions are easier to clean. If you prefer low-maintenance appliances, look for a coffee maker with these features. Regular cleaning is essential to prevent buildup and ensure the best-tasting coffee, so choose a machine that fits your cleaning preferences and routine.
Size and DesignSize and design refer to the physical dimensions and aesthetic appeal of the coffee maker. This is important for ensuring the machine fits in your kitchen space and matches your decor. Coffee makers come in various sizes, from compact single-serve machines to larger drip coffee makers. If you have limited counter space, a smaller machine may be more suitable. Additionally, consider the design and color of the coffee maker to ensure it complements your kitchen. Choose a size and design that fits your space and personal style.
